Product range
Swivel and snap product families we can supply
Swivels and snaps are usually purchased by size, strength, rotation performance, snap structure, finish, application and packaging format. A complete terminal tackle range may include several swivel types, snap types and size groups for different fishing markets.
Barrel Swivels
Common swivel type for general fishing rigs, sinker connections and retail tackle packs. Buyers usually compare size, strength and finish.
Rolling Swivels
Used where smoother rotation and reduced line twist are required. Size consistency, rotation and tensile strength are key buying points.
Snap Swivels
Snap swivels combine swivel rotation with quick connection. Snap opening, closing strength and rotation should be checked together.
Interlock Snaps
Common snap style for lures, leaders and terminal rigs. Buyers should review wire diameter, opening feel, lock security and finish.
Coastlock Snaps
Stronger snap style for saltwater, trolling and heavier lure fishing. Opening strength, wire quality and corrosion resistance matter.
Ball Bearing Swivels
Used for trolling, offshore fishing and higher strength applications. Rotation under tension and finish quality should be reviewed.
Common supply range
Typical swivel and snap sizes, strength ranges and buyer use
The following table is a practical reference for product planning. Exact specifications should be confirmed according to size system, strength requirement, wire diameter, finish, packaging and target market.
| Product type | Common size range | Common finish | Typical buyer use |
|---|---|---|---|
| Barrel swivels | #14–#1/0 | Nickel, black nickel, brass color | General rigs, sinker rigs, freshwater fishing and entry-level terminal tackle ranges. |
| Rolling swivels | #12–#2/0 | Nickel, black nickel, stainless-style finish | Lure fishing, leader rigs, reduced line twist and higher rotation requirements. |
| Snap swivels | #14–#5/0 | Nickel, black nickel, brass color | Quick lure change, general rigs, sinkers, leaders and retail terminal tackle packs. |
| Interlock snaps | #000–#5 | Nickel, black nickel, stainless-style finish | Freshwater lure fishing, small lures, leaders and general terminal tackle programs. |
| Coastlock snaps | #00–#6/0 | Nickel, black nickel, stainless steel | Saltwater fishing, trolling, heavier lures and stronger connection requirements. |
| Ball bearing swivels | #0–#8/0 | Nickel, black nickel, stainless-style finish | Offshore trolling, heavy saltwater fishing and premium terminal tackle programs. |
Buying guide
How buyers should compare swivels and snaps
Swivels and snaps may look simple, but buyer complaints usually come from weak strength, poor rotation, loose snap closing, burrs, rust, inconsistent sizes or unclear packaging. Specifications should be reviewed carefully before quotation.
Size System
Size numbers can differ between suppliers. Buyers should confirm length, wire diameter, ring size and actual product dimensions.
Strength
Tensile strength should match target fish, line class and fishing method. Strength claims should be realistic for the product size.
Rotation
Swivel rotation matters for line twist control. Rolling and ball bearing swivels should rotate smoothly under appropriate tension.
Snap Security
Snap wire strength, opening feel and lock security should match lure weight, fishing method and target market.
Size and finish planning
Swivel and snap ranges should be planned by application and market level
A terminal tackle range should not only list sizes. Buyers should confirm whether the products are used for freshwater rigs, carp rigs, lure fishing, saltwater fishing, trolling or heavy-duty applications.
- Freshwater rigs: smaller barrel swivels, rolling swivels and snap swivels are common for general fishing use.
- Lure fishing: snap strength, quick opening and clean wire shape are important for repeated lure changes.
- Saltwater use: stronger wire, corrosion-resistant finish and heavier snap structures should be reviewed.
- Carp tackle: matte black, anti-glare finishes and compatibility with clips, sleeves and rig systems may be required.
- Retail ranges: clear size naming, pack count, barcode and packaging consistency help stores and distributors.

QC focus
Swivel and snap quality control before shipment
Swivel and snap QC should focus on size consistency, tensile strength, rotation, snap opening and closing, burrs, surface finish, rust marks, pack count and label accuracy.
| QC item | Inspection focus | Common issue to avoid |
|---|---|---|
| Size consistency | Check product length, wire diameter, ring size, snap size and size grouping. | Mixed sizes, wrong size label or inconsistent dimensions. |
| Strength | Check tensile strength, snap wire strength and weak connection points. | Weak wire, open snap, broken ring or unrealistic strength claim. |
| Rotation | Check swivel movement, smooth rotation and blockage under normal use. | Rough rotation, stuck swivel, bent body or poor assembly. |
| Surface finish | Check plating, black nickel finish, burrs, sharp edges and rust marks. | Burrs, scratches, rust, uneven plating or sharp wire ends. |
| Packaging | Check pack count, size label, barcode, bag sealing and SKU separation. | Wrong count, mixed sizes, wrong label or damaged retail packaging. |
